HEM entered their tilt with Rock River on Saturday with five consecutive wins but they'll enter their next game with six. They put the hurt on the Rock River Longhorns with a sharp 40-20 victory. That's the second time they've managed to beat them this season, as they also won 41-12 back in January.
HEM pushed their record up to 10-5 with the win, which was their third straight on the road. Those victories came thanks in part to their defensive effort, having only surrendered 10.7 points over those games. As for Rock River, they have been struggling recently as they've lost eight of their last nine games, which has put a noticeable dent in their 2-10 record this season.
HEM has already played their next matchup (against Encampment), but no score has been uploaded at the time of writing. As for Rock River, they will square off against Lingle-Fort Laramie at 3:30 p.m. on Friday.
